Identify the functional groups present in monosaccharides. Monosaccharides contain hydroxyl groups (-OH) and an aldehyde or ketone group.
Understand the process of dehydration synthesis, where two monosaccharides join together. This involves the removal of a water molecule.
Recognize that the bond formed between two monosaccharides is called a glycosidic bond. This bond is an ether linkage formed between the anomeric carbon of one sugar and a hydroxyl group of another.
Differentiate glycosidic bonds from other types of bonds such as ester bonds (formed between acids and alcohols) and peptide bonds (formed between amino acids).
Conclude that polysaccharides are formed by linking multiple monosaccharides through glycosidic bonds, resulting in complex carbohydrates.
